I live on a busy street in Vancouver where car alarms go off probably 5 times a day outside of my apartment. Thankfully, the city has some regulation when it comes to noise pollution. I have the by-law control on speed dial and call them up when a car alarm has gone off more than 3 times in a 24 hour period or longer than 60 seconds continuously. They'll send a tow truck and tow the bas**rd and I'll be laughing from my balcony.
The day of the car alarm has come and gone. In BC at least all 2005 car models and on are legislated to be fitted with an immobilizer instead of a car alarm. They will gradually be phased out with a new auto fleet.
